Benefits of Sheet Metal Prototyping

  • It is easy to having an idea but difficult to describe in front of others. Prototypes work as a tangible example of what one is looking to produce and it will make you easy to explain benefits of your products and differences as compare to other existing devices.
  • This process helps you in the testing and evaluation of the design of your final product to ensure that are defect free. You can test the designs, modify it by calculating all the possible errors and make the final product error free.
  • In addition, It saves your production and cost both such as by creating sample first you can analyze the product design that help you to save your wastage of materials and workmanship and the cost also that you are going to spend on mass production first.
  • This also helps to increase the market by creating sample to augment sales sheets and brochures in order to highlight all the benefits and features of the final product in front of the customers.
  • It also helps you to try diverse ideas and innovations while creating a sample first as well as also saves your time and cost both.
